First-Line Supervisors of Correctional Officers · SOC 33-1011

First-Line Supervisors of Correctional Officers Salary in the Fayetteville Metro Area

Source: BLS OEWS, May 2025Fayetteville, NC metro area

Figures describe the Fayetteville, NC metropolitan statistical area as defined by BLS/OMB — the whole multi-county metro region, not Fayetteville city limits.

Median annual wage$57,910
Median hourly wage$27.84

First-Line Supervisors of Correctional Officers in the Fayetteville, NC metro area earned a median of $57,910 per year ($27.84 per hour) as of the May 2025 BLS OEWS estimates. Pay ranged from $48,850 at the 10th percentile to $72,330 at the 90th. BLS estimates 30 people work in this occupation in the area.

About this estimate

These figures are survey estimates from the B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ics program — modeled from employer reports collected over three years and benchmarked to May 2025. They describe what employers in this area currently pay across all industries, not what any individual worker will be offered.

Employment counts wage-and-salary jobs in the occupation (self-employed workers are excluded). Estimates carry sampling error; percentile wages are rounded by BLS. Some values are suppressed by BLS for confidentiality or quality — suppressed values appear here as “not published”, never as zero. Read the full methodology.
